Try looking here - 

C:\Documents and Settings\%USERNAME%\Local Settings\Application
Data\Microsoft\Outlook

PSTs and OSTs are usually stored in the above folder.  If the file was
deleted, you can try using a file restore program like "EasyRecovery"
from www.ontrack.com to recover the file.
